Где сохраняются временные файлы Excel: поиск и восстановление

При внезапном отключении электричества или системном сбое программа Microsoft Excel пытается сохранить резервную копию открытого документа в скрытых системных папках операционной системы. По умолчанию эти временные файлы размещаются по пути C:\Users\ИмяПользователя\AppData\Local\Microsoft\Office\UnsavedFiles или в папке AutoRecover внутри профиля пользователя. Если вы ищете потерянные данные, именно эти директории становятся первичной точкой поиска, куда приложение сбрасывает буфер обмена перед критической ошибкой.

Механизм автосохранения работает в фоновом режиме, создавая копии с расширением .xlsb или временным префиксом ~, которые не всегда видны в стандартном проводнике без включения отображения скрытых элементов. Понимание структуры хранения этих данных критически важно для специалистов по восстановлению информации и обычных пользователей, желающих минимизировать потери рабочего времени. В отличие от штатного сохранения, временные файлы могут быть повреждены или удалены системой при плановой очистке диска, поэтому действовать необходимо оперативно.

Стандартные пути расположения автосохранения

Операционная система Windows строго регламентирует места, куда Excel записывает данные для восстановления. Основным хранилищем служит папка AutoRecover, путь к которой можно проверить и изменить в настройках самого приложения. Для большинства современных версий офисного пакета актуален адрес, содержащий идентификатор пользователя и версию программы, например, C:\Users\[User]\AppData\Roaming\Microsoft\Excel\. Здесь хранятся файлы с расширением .xlk или временные версии, помеченные временем создания.

Кроме основной папки восстановления, существует директория UnsavedFiles, куда попадают документы, которые пользователь никогда не сохранял вручную, но работал с ними достаточно долго. Система воспринимает такие файлы как потенциально важные и создает их копии, чтобы предотвратить полную потерю данных при крахе процесса EXCEL.EXE. Найти эту папку можно, введя соответствующий путь в адресную строку проводника или воспользовавшись командой %appdata% для быстрого перехода.

Важно отметить, что расположение может варьироваться в зависимости от корпоративных политик безопасности или настроек групповых политик Active Directory. В таких случаях администраторы могут перенаправить поток временных файлов на сетевые ресурсы или в изолированные разделы диска. Если стандартные пути не содержат искомых данных, имеет смысл проверить реестр Windows или параметры среды, где может быть прописан альтер-нативный каталог для автоматического восстановления.

Настройка параметров автосохранения в Excel

Чтобы гарантировать сохранность данных, необходимо правильно настроить интервалы автосохранения в меню параметров программы. По умолчанию Excel создает копии каждые 10 минут, однако для сложных вычислений этот интервал лучше сократить до 1-2 минут. Для изменения настроек перейдите в меню Файл > Параметры > Сохранение, где расположен блок Автовосстановление. Здесь можно не только изменить частоту, но и отключить функцию для файлов, не требующих резервирования.

В этом же разделе настроек отображается точный путь к папке, где сейчас хранятся все создаваемые резервные копии. Вы можете скопировать этот путь и вставить его в проводник, чтобы быстро перейти к файлам в случае необходимости. Также здесь доступна опция сохранения последней автосохраненной версии при закрытии файла без сохранения, что служит дополнительной страховкой от ошибочных действий пользователя.

☑️ Проверка настроек безопасности

Выполнено: 0 / 4

Следует учитывать, что частое автосохранение больших файлов с сложными макросами может временно снижать производительность системы во время записи на диск. Если вы работаете с массивами данных объемом в гигабайты, оптимальным решением будет баланс между частотой сохранения и нагрузкой на дисковую подсистему. В таких случаях рекомендуется использовать твердотельные накопители (SSD), которые справляются с частой записью мелких файлов без задержек.

Поиск временных файлов через системные команды

Если графический интерфейс не позволяет найти нужную директорию, можно воспользоваться командной строкой или PowerShell для сканирования диска. Введение команды dir /s /b *.tmp в корневой директории диска C запустит рекурсивный поиск всех временных файлов, созданных различными приложениями, включая Excel. Однако этот метод требует фильтрации результатов, так как список может содержать тысячи системных файлов других программ.

Более точным методом является поиск по специфическим маскам имен, которые Microsoft Office присваивает своим временным файлам. Часто они начинаются с символа тильды (~) или имеют префикс AutoRecover. Использование команды search ~.xls в PowerShell позволяет отфильтровать лишнее и найти именно те документы, которые были открыты в табличном редакторе недавно.

⚠️ Внимание: При работе с командной строкой будьте осторожны при удалении файлов. Удаление системных временных файлов других процессов может привести к нестабильной работе Windows.

Для автоматизации поиска можно создать простой скрипт, который будет сканировать стандартные папки профилей пользователей и выводить список найденных файлов с датой последней модификации. Это особенно полезно для системных администраторов, восстанавливающих данные на компьютерах сотрудников после массовых сбоев электропитания.

Анализ таблицы расположения файлов восстановления

Различные типы файлов и сценарии работы с Excel подразумевают использование разных механизмов сохранения. Понимание различий между автосохранением, автосохранением OneDrive и ручным резервным копированием помогает быстрее сориентироваться в критической ситуации. Ниже приведена таблица, систематизирующая основные типы временных файлов и их местоположение.

Тип файла Расширение Типовое расположение Условие создания
Автосохранение .xlsb / .tmp AppData\Local\Microsoft\Office\UnsavedFiles Интервальное сохранение (по умолчанию 10 мин)
Резервная копия .xlk Папка с оригинальным файлом При включенной опции "Всегда создавать резервную копию"
Временный файл .tmp C:\Users\[User]\AppData\Local\Temp Во время активной работы с документом
Файл блокировки .~lock. Папка с оригинальным файлом При открытии файла любым пользователем
Технические детали форматов

Временные файлы .tmp могут содержать фрагментарные данные, которые невозможно открыть стандартным способом без переименования расширения или использования специализированных утилит восстановления структуры файла.>

Анализ этой таблицы показывает, что наиболее надежным источником данных является папка UnsavedFiles, так как она предназначена специально для хранения целостных копий документов. Файлы в папке Temp часто фрагментированы и могут быть перезаписаны системой в любой момент, поэтому их восстановление требует профессионального подхода.

Использование облачных функций для поиска данных

Современные версии Office 365 и Excel активно интегрированы с облачными сервисами, такими как OneDrive и SharePoint. Если вы работаете с файлами, сохраненными в облаке, механизм автосохранения работает иначе: каждая изменение фиксируется практически в реальном времени, а история версий хранится на сервере. Это означает, что локальные временные файлы могут не создаваться или быть вторичными.

Для доступа к предыдущим версиям облачного документа достаточно кликнуть правой кнопкой мыши по файлу в проводнике или веб-интерфейсе и выбрать пункт Журнал версий. Там можно увидеть детальную хронологию изменений, кто и когда вносил правки, и при необходимости откатиться к состоянию файла на любой момент времени за последние 30 дней (или дольше, в зависимости от политики компании).

Преимущество облачного хранения заключается в том, что даже при полном разрушении жесткого диска данные останутся доступны с любого другого устройства. Однако это требует стабильного подключения к интернету и правильной настройки синхронизации клиента OneDrive на рабочем месте.

Специфика работы с макросами и временными файлами

Если в документе используются макросы VBA, процесс сохранения временных файлов может иметь свои особенности. Некоторые макросы могут принудительно изменять путь сохранения или блокировать стандартную процедуру автосохранения в целях безопасности. В таких случаях временные файлы могут создаваться в нестандартных директориях, указанных в коде программы.

При отладке макросов часто создаются промежуточные файлы, которые не удаляются автоматически после завершения работы кода. Эти файлы могут занимать значительное место на диске и содержать чувствительную информацию. Рекомендуется регулярно проводить аудит папок Temp и AppData, удаляя старые файлы, созданные более 24 часов назад.

⚠️ Внимание: Никогда не открывайте временные файлы из неизвестных источников, так как через механизм макросов в них может быть внедрен вредоносный код.

Для защиты от потери данных при работе с макросами используйте функцию Application.EnableAutoRecover = True в начале кода, если она была отключена. Это гарантирует, что даже в случае ошибки выполнения кода Excel попытается сохранить текущее состояние документа.

Чистка системы и предотвращение накопления мусора

Регулярная очистка папок с временными файлами необходима для поддержания быстродействия системы. Со временем папка AppData может разрастаться до нескольких гигабайт, что замедляет работу Windows и самого Excel. Используйте встроенную утилиту "Очистка диска" или сторонние программы, настроив их на безопасное удаление только тех файлов, возраст которых превышает неделю.

Важно не удалять файлы, которые были созданы в текущую рабочую сессию, так как они могут быть необходимы для восстановления незавершенных задач. Перед запуском глубокой очистки убедитесь, что все важные документы сохранены и закрыты, а процессы EXCEL.EXE завершены в диспетчере задач.

Правильная организация работы с временными файлами — это баланс между безопасностью данных и чистотой файловой системы. Понимание того, где сохраняются временные файлы Excel, дает вам контроль над процессом и уверенность в том, что ни одна важная цифра не будет потеряна безвозвратно.

Часто задаваемые вопросы (FAQ)

Можно ли изменить стандартный путь для временных файлов Excel?

Да, это можно сделать через реестр Windows или групповые политики, изменив значение ключа, отвечающего за путь к папке автосохранения. Однако для обычных пользователей проще использовать настройки внутри самого приложения в меню параметров.

Как открыть файл с расширением .tmp в Excel?

Прямое открытие невозможно. Необходимо переименовать расширение файла на .xls или .xlsx, после чего попробовать открыть его. Если структура файла не повреждена, Excel сможет распознать данные.

Сколько времени хранятся файлы автосохранения?

По умолчанию файлы хранятся до тех пор, пока вы не закроете документ успешно. Если документ был закрыт с ошибкой, файлы могут храниться в папке восстановления до 4 дней или до момента ручной очистки пользователем.

Почему Excel не создает временные файлы?

Возможно, функция автосохранения отключена в настройках, диск переполнен, или файл открыт в режиме "Только для чтения". Также причиной может быть работа антивируса, блокирующего запись в системные папки.